Hi Bruce,
This is a trial merge of the stable kernel v5.15.198 v6.1.161 v6.12.66 v6.6.121
for the following branches in the linux-yocto.
0ff05451b13b 20260120/v5.15/standard/sdkv5.10/axxia
4b52b4c36377 20260120/v5.15/standard/preempt-rt/sdkv5.10/axxia
56fa8cc7d09e 20260120/v5.15/standard/base
3ec70712b438 20260120/v5.15/standard/preempt-rt/base
796c98f6845f 20260120/v5.15/standard/cn-sdkv5.4/octeon
87859639e4c6 20260120/v5.15/standard/preempt-rt/cn-sdkv5.4/octeon
6e8255770cfb 20260120/v5.15/standard/cn-sdkv5.15/octeon
b31ecc3b236b 20260120/v5.15/standard/preempt-rt/cn-sdkv5.15/octeon
50433ac5b97a 20260120/v5.15/standard/cn-sdk-12.25.02-6/octeon
2c281df5fbcb 20260120/v5.15/standard/preempt-rt/cn-sdk-12.25.02-6/octeon
be1094d55283 20260120/v5.15/standard/ti-sdk-5.10/ti-j72xx
#Have textual conflicts
a6ae00803039 20260120/v5.15/standard/preempt-rt/ti-sdk-5.10/ti-j72xx
#Have textual conflicts
dfd7d0443cd0 20260120/v5.15/standard/nxp-sdk-5.15/nxp-soc
#Have textual conflicts
753d7143d158 20260120/v5.15/standard/preempt-rt/nxp-sdk-5.15/nxp-soc
#Have textual conflicts
e135d1f5ff8f 20260120/v5.15/standard/nvidia-orin
#Have textual conflicts
46f9a05465bf 20260120/v5.15/standard/preempt-rt/nvidia-orin
#Have textual conflicts
2a966cee4388 20260120/v5.15/standard/bcm-2xxx-rpi
140770a140b8 20260120/v5.15/standard/preempt-rt/bcm-2xxx-rpi
a9c463b4877b 20260120/v5.15/standard/nxp-sdk-5.15/nxp-s32g
#Have textual conflicts
da8bec941077 20260120/v5.15/standard/preempt-rt/nxp-sdk-5.15/nxp-s32g
#Have textual conflicts
67135caf327b 20260120/v5.15/standard/nxp-sdk-5.10/nxp-s32g
#Have textual conflicts
cf095a28ba93 20260120/v5.15/standard/preempt-rt/nxp-sdk-5.10/nxp-s32g
#Have textual conflicts
278cdb86107a 20260120/v5.15/standard/intel-sdk-5.15/intel-socfpga
347ad6059d28 20260120/v5.15/standard/preempt-rt/intel-sdk-5.15/intel-socfpga
9417e6050f94 20260120/v5.15/standard/x86
8e67e7e1088b 20260120/v5.15/standard/preempt-rt/x86
71acb5383506 20260120/v5.15/standard/sdkv5.15/xlnx-soc
#Have textual conflicts
849565508cdb 20260120/v5.15/standard/preempt-rt/sdkv5.15/xlnx-soc
#Have textual conflicts
9cf4aae1cb14 20260120/v6.1/standard/sdkv5.10/axxia
0e13cea4ea66 20260120/v6.1/standard/preempt-rt/sdkv5.10/axxia
aabc918b3ca1 20260120/v6.1/standard/base
997fdc9eff56 20260120/v6.1/standard/preempt-rt/base
e6e85ad1a5e8 20260120/v6.1/standard/ti-sdk-6.1/ti-j7xxx
dfe59ff1fad5 20260120/v6.1/standard/preempt-rt/ti-sdk-6.1/ti-j7xxx
919de1a8d3b0 20260120/v6.1/standard/ti-sdk-5.10/ti-j7xxx
#Have textual conflicts
7c1dfa6cd63c 20260120/v6.1/standard/preempt-rt/ti-sdk-5.10/ti-j7xxx
#Have textual conflicts
9e6e2bc29aa7 20260120/v6.1/standard/nxp-sdk-6.1/nxp-soc
577ed69036a3 20260120/v6.1/standard/preempt-rt/nxp-sdk-6.1/nxp-soc
541d18422f2b 20260120/v6.1/standard/cn-sdkv5.15/octeon
77c6f95d93bd 20260120/v6.1/standard/preempt-rt/cn-sdkv5.15/octeon
9b753bb74bfd 20260120/v6.1/standard/cn-sdkv6.1/octeon
a19f7882ac1d 20260120/v6.1/standard/preempt-rt/cn-sdkv6.1/octeon
b02ffec30edf 20260120/v6.1/standard/microchip-polarfire-soc
6903aaa09b4d 20260120/v6.1/standard/preempt-rt/microchip-polarfire-soc
dbfbbba5b3db 20260120/v6.1/standard/bcm-2xxx-rpi
9c3bc5bc2dfc 20260120/v6.1/standard/preempt-rt/bcm-2xxx-rpi
6b501d3ee0f7 20260120/v6.1/standard/nxp-sdk-5.15/nxp-s32g
2011728a4edc 20260120/v6.1/standard/preempt-rt/nxp-sdk-5.15/nxp-s32g
e6c3595c12b9 20260120/v6.1/standard/intel-sdk-6.1/intel-socfpga
e4b143a9e799 20260120/v6.1/standard/preempt-rt/intel-sdk-6.1/intel-socfpga
3d65912f9c55 20260120/v6.1/standard/x86
231ffc6bd8f8 20260120/v6.1/standard/preempt-rt/x86
2fe8d71a127a 20260120/v6.1/standard/sdkv6.1/xlnx-soc
3bf54dba880c 20260120/v6.1/standard/preempt-rt/sdkv6.1/xlnx-soc
795a428cceee 20260120/v6.12/standard/base
f597f6197d7f 20260120/v6.12/standard/preempt-rt/base
b27d62fd42e5 20260120/v6.12/standard/nvidia-sdk-5.15/nvidia-soc
186361ed6ac5 20260120/v6.12/standard/preempt-rt/nvidia-sdk-5.15/nvidia-soc
c2dc06830771 20260120/v6.12/standard/nxp-sdk-6.12/nxp-soc
#Have textual conflicts
02c263e11361 20260120/v6.12/standard/preempt-rt/nxp-sdk-6.12/nxp-soc
#Have textual conflicts
c56afd178d3f 20260120/v6.12/standard/octeon
5ad00a8ef0c3 20260120/v6.12/standard/preempt-rt/octeon
35dd7ab27e46 20260120/v6.12/standard/bcm-2xxx-rpi
e9bcad1190cd 20260120/v6.12/standard/preempt-rt/bcm-2xxx-rpi
c2838ab8b123 20260120/v6.12/standard/nxp-sdk-6.6/nxp-s32g
a7ae2dac593b 20260120/v6.12/standard/preempt-rt/nxp-sdk-6.6/nxp-s32g
6210a221a53e 20260120/v6.12/standard/intel-socfpga
c11cbdbdf727 20260120/v6.12/standard/preempt-rt/intel-socfpga
626696bd89f2 20260120/v6.12/standard/ti-soc
#Have textual conflicts
37c936362e8c 20260120/v6.12/standard/preempt-rt/ti-soc
#Have textual conflicts
a2bb52c87a49 20260120/v6.12/standard/x86
da4b9f9407cb 20260120/v6.12/standard/preempt-rt/x86
f11feb86e0b5 20260120/v6.12/standard/xlnx-soc
#Have textual conflicts
df37dc9a84d7 20260120/v6.12/standard/preempt-rt/xlnx-soc
#Have textual conflicts
52cde1eedb6d 20260120/v6.6/standard/sdkv5.15/axxia
506b626fcab6 20260120/v6.6/standard/preempt-rt/sdkv5.15/axxia
662afc9722c9 20260120/v6.6/standard/base
c79ee8ce8cbc 20260120/v6.6/standard/preempt-rt/base
e61c8d2bbc89 20260120/v6.6/standard/nxp-sdk-6.6/nxp-soc
#Have textual conflicts
d231ef84427b 20260120/v6.6/standard/preempt-rt/nxp-sdk-6.6/nxp-soc
#Have textual conflicts
2cfcf393f471 20260120/v6.6/standard/cn-sdkv6.1/octeon
2b5218df5b1b 20260120/v6.6/standard/preempt-rt/cn-sdkv6.1/octeon
7693a2898de6 20260120/v6.6/standard/cn-sdkv6.6/octeon
7e56a76cd425 20260120/v6.6/standard/preempt-rt/cn-sdkv6.6/octeon
1e2290272d9c 20260120/v6.6/standard/nvidia-orin
35361d2cb2b4 20260120/v6.6/standard/preempt-rt/nvidia-orin
3c2d19f314dd 20260120/v6.6/standard/microchip-polarfire-soc
f757b7cbcf1f 20260120/v6.6/standard/preempt-rt/microchip-polarfire-soc
20b4401ab131 20260120/v6.6/standard/bcm-2xxx-rpi
e45aef8bd237 20260120/v6.6/standard/preempt-rt/bcm-2xxx-rpi
131271f37d95 20260120/v6.6/standard/nxp-sdk-6.6/nxp-s32g
3f496311ce3d 20260120/v6.6/standard/preempt-rt/nxp-sdk-6.6/nxp-s32g
983468fef2c8 20260120/v6.6/standard/intel-sdk-6.6/intel-socfpga
b7c8ffcb587a 20260120/v6.6/standard/preempt-rt/intel-sdk-6.6/intel-socfpga
396cdd609071 20260120/v6.6/standard/ti-sdk-6.6/ti-soc
c1104337c6c5 20260120/v6.6/standard/preempt-rt/ti-sdk-6.6/ti-soc
4569dc596778 20260120/v6.6/standard/x86
8b1b35e978f8 20260120/v6.6/standard/preempt-rt/x86
c7e793516ba2 20260120/v6.6/standard/sdkv6.6/xlnx-soc
0dee88df345a 20260120/v6.6/standard/preempt-rt/sdkv6.6/xlnx-soc
The majority of merge conflicts originate from the v5.15 and v6.12 kernels.
The following ones require additional attention:
- For v5.15 nxp branches:
Since the definition of struct fsl_xcvr_soc_data has been moved to fsl_xcvr.h
in the SDK commit, we must also apply the changes from stable commit
650127b100b1
("ASoC: fsl_xcvr: Add support for i.MX93 platform") to fsl_xcvr.h.
- For v5.15 orin branches:
There are numerous conflicting changes in the drivers/spi/spi-tegra210-quad.c
file.
This situation arises because some similar patches have been applied to both
the
SDK and stable kernel, while other patches are entirely different between the
two.
In certain cases, we must adopt the code from the SDK commit, whereas in
others,
we should select the changes from the stable commit.
All branches have passed my build tests, and I have pushed them to:
https://github.com/haokexin/linux
You can use this as a reference for the linux-yocto stable kernel bump.
Thanks,
Kevin
-=-=-=-=-=-=-=-=-=-=-=-
Links: You receive all messages sent to this group.
View/Reply Online (#16189):
https://lists.yoctoproject.org/g/linux-yocto/message/16189
Mute This Topic: https://lists.yoctoproject.org/mt/117362096/21656
Group Owner: [email protected]
Unsubscribe: https://lists.yoctoproject.org/g/linux-yocto/unsub
[[email protected]]
-=-=-=-=-=-=-=-=-=-=-=-